Visual aids designed to educate caregivers on the correct selection, installation, and usage of child restraint systems. These displays often incorporate illustrations, concise instructions, and key safety guidelines to promote proper car seat practices. For example, a display may feature step-by-step instructions on how to correctly secure a rear-facing car seat in a vehicle.
The displays offer a readily accessible and easily understandable resource for parents and guardians, potentially reducing misuse and injury risks. Historically, such visuals have played a role in public health campaigns, aiming to disseminate critical safety information to a broad audience. They reinforce the significance of correct implementation, and the protective value car seats offer.
